The Trump administration has proposed raising North American auto content requirements to 82% under a revised U.S.-Mexico-Canada trade agreement, with half of that content required to originate from the U.S., according to proposals revealed during bilateral trade talks.
Trump administration wants to raise North American auto content to 82%, with half from U.S.
The proposed new thresholds were revealed to automakers during two days of bilateral talks to revise the U.S.-Mexico-Canada Agreement on trade that concluded on Friday.
